A multiscale approach to discrete element modeling is presented. distinctive feature of the method that each macroscopic has an associated atomic sample representing material’s structure. The dynamics elements on macro and micro levels are described by systems ordinary differential equations, which solved in a self-consistent manner. full cycle simulations applied polycrystalline silicon. Macroscale elastic properties silicon were obtained only using data extracted from quantum mechanical properties. results computational experiments correspond well reference data.
